In a heartfelt tribute on the seventh death anniversary of former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ee, Prime Minister Narendra Modi emphasized Vajpayee's enduring impact on India's developmental journey. Modi, along with President Droupadi Murmu and other dignitaries, gathered at the 'Sadaiv Atal' memorial to honor the late leader.
Described as a poet and statesman, Vajpayee served as Prime Minister from 1998 to 2004, spearheading economic reforms that ignited a period of robust growth. His legacy continues to inspire efforts towards a self-reliant India, Modi highlighted on X, noting Vajpayee's unwavering dedication to national progress.
Vajpayee, known for his moderate image and broad appeal, played a pivotal role in the BJP's rise to prominence, guiding the party through two successful coalition governments. Revered for his affability and leadership, his governance marked the first successful national coalition in India.
